Everything looks the same as the original factory ones, lights are little more blue tinted than the factory buttons but didn't bother me at all and the lights are fairly bright. As for installation, if you watch any of the videos that talk about just pulling the buttons out and trying to remove the clips that way, I'd highly recommend not doing that and taking the steering wheel off to do it. Taking the steering wheel off only takes an extra 2-3 minutes and and 21mm wrench but makes it so much easier to install. At first I tried to do the "easy" way and just remove the buttons but I messed the with the clips for probably 15 minutes and wasn't able to get them plugged in until I decided to just remove the steering wheel.

These units replaced the 18-year old original equipment in our Yukon. The finish is matte black and most of the characters are equivalent to the originals, except the lower left hand/disappearing road buttons. The other issue is the way the arrows and words are aligned on the top right button. The final difference versus the originals is the color; the replacements have a soft blue hue whereas the GM originals are greenish. Electrically, they operate just like the originals.

The switches look almost like the oringals, just the road icon is a little different, but nobody would know if the old one was side by side to the new one. Not the manufacturers fault, but the lights are white and I missed that when I ordered them and they don't match the Sierra green dash lights exactly, but the switches made up for that! (I attached a photos, so you can see the difference). I replaced these due to having no lights on my steering wheel and wore out switches not working. Took me about 15 minutes to replace, using a 90° pick and removing the airbag to get a little more play in the wires. Make sure to disconnect your battery for 10-15 minutes before removing the airbag. Once the switches were removed the trick to getting the new ones in, is to make sure you have the 90° angle pick and hook the plug in the back, in-between the wires and get the new switch lined up, slowly feed/push the new switch into place while holding the wires with the pick. Once the plug snaps into place carefully pull the pick away from the wires and turn it 90° degrees and slide it out between the new switch and steering wheel. There are some YouTube videos out there! Good luck! Overall pretty happy. All the switches work as they should.

The ones I got work flawlessly. I was skeptical after reading some reviews as to how much brighter they were compared to other backlighting on the dash but these were perfect. Everyone of them lit up as intended. I think some of the negative reviews concerning nonworking issues stems from improper removal and installation. I would not use a tool to try and poke down the side to release the latch holding them in. The wires going to the plug are way too short to work with anyway and you will only wind up damaging it. Instead, do yourself a favor by removing the steering wheel and releasing the clamps holding the wiring in place. Takes ten minutes and very easy to do. YouTube is your friend.
